Am looking at clearing a hefty bank to the side of my place so as to form (initially), a hard standing/parking area and (ultimately) a site for a workshop. The bank is a brute, approx 2m in height but happily stable, not water logged and is not heavily loaded above/behind (neighbours garden only supported). I originally started off having a design done for a cantilevered poured concrete retaining wall that would be integral with the hard pad and reinforced with tie rods etc. Budget and time now indicates a modular gravity system might be more effective assuming something aesthetically suitable and robust enough can be sourced.... any experiences?
